Flyes

The fly is performed while lying face up on a bench, with arms outspread holding dumbbells, by bringing the arms together above the chest. This is an isolation exercise for the pectorals.

Many gyms also have Pec Deck machines where you sit upright to perform the same movement while under resistance.

To target different areas of the chest, then perform incline flyes to target the upper pectorals, and decline flyes to target the lower pectorals.
